Role of key residues of obelin in coelenterazine binding and conversion into 2-hydroperoxy adduct.
Journal of photochemistry and photobiology. B, Biology - 5 Oct 2013
Eremeeva Elena V, Markova Svetlana V, van Berkel Willem J H, Vysotski Eugene S
Abstract excerpt
Bioluminescence of a variety of marine organisms is caused by monomeric Ca(2+)-regulated photoproteins, to which a peroxy-substituted coelenterazine, 2-hydroperoxycoelenterazine, is firmly bound. From the spatial structure the side chains of Tyr138, His175, Trp179, and Tyr190 of obelin are situated within the substrate-binding pocket at hydrogen bond distances with different atoms of the...
